summary:

gh-82088: Improve performance of PyLong_As*() for multi-digit ints (#135585)

+Improve performance of ``PyLongObject`` conversion functions
+``PyLong_AsLongAndOverflow()``, ``PyLong_AsSsize_t()``, 
``PyLong_AsUnsignedLong()``, ``PyLong_AsSize_t()``,
+``PyLong_AsUnsignedLongMask()``, ``PyLong_AsUnsignedLongLongMask()``, 
``PyLong_AsLongLongAndOverflow()``
+for integers larger than 2**30 up to 30%.
